Bombardier shares fell 7% to C$293.49 on the Toronto Stock Exchange (TSX) on Tuesday morning before regaining some later in the day. It’s the first trading day since the president floated a ban on Bombardier jet sales in the U.S. over the Labour Day weekend.
Analysts say it’s not clear what legal mechanism this American administration would use to stop the company from exporting into the U.S. Bombardier jets are cleared for sale in the U.S. under certifications obtained by the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A).
